you will never have to be alone

 

Before you I was alone like a tunnel, but I didn’t know it

Birds fled from me and I believed there was a magic in my dying slowly

Then in the dark night while the wind disentangled itself from my body

I saw your eyes like constellations, playful but honest and unchanging

A silver gull slipped down from the east

My angel

 

My angel

I will carry you like an arrow in my bow, a stone in my sling

I will clasp you in my arms like a moonflower vine

I will be delicate because I know your heart is a paper crane and my hands are made of fire

And more than anything else, I will love you

My half of the moon,

White fire lily

Forge of blue metals

Cross over my heart and never let me go
